"Antes" Meaning

"Antes" is a Spanish word that means "before" or "formerly" in English. It is used to indicate a time or situation that occurred prior to another event or condition.

"Antes" Examples

1. Antes de ir al trabajo, siempre tomo un desayuno saludable.
2. En esta situación, es mejor ser previsor; antes de comenzar el proyecto, asegúrate de tener todos los recursos necesarios.
3. La película fue buena, pero no tan impresionante como la novelística original; la versión en libro era mucho más detallada y emocionante antes de su adaptación cinematográfica.
4. Los científicos estudiaron las condiciones del clima antes de la era industrial para entender mejor cómo ha cambiado con el tiempo.
5. Me gusta levantarme temprano; así tengo tiempo de hacer ejercicio antes de que comience la ajetreada jornada laboral.

Anterolisthesis

Anterolisthesis is a medical term referring to a condition where one vertebra in the spine slips forward over the vertebra below it. This displacement usually occurs at the lumbar region (lower back) and can lead to various symptoms, such as back pain, nerve compression, and muscle weakness. It is often caused by degenerative changes, injury, or instability in the spine.

Anteromedial

The term "anteromedial" refers to a direction or location that is both anterior (towards the front) and medial (towards the midline) of a structure or body part. For example, in anatomical descriptions, it might be used to describe a position on the thigh that is both towards the front and closer to the midline of the body.
